Understanding Promotional Mechanics in Online Slots
Promotions in online slot gaming serve multiple functions, from customer acquisition to loyalty retention. Common types include welcome bonuses, free spins, cashback offers, and reload bonuses. These incentives often aim to mitigate the house edge inherent in slots by providing additional play opportunities, thereby enhancing user engagement.
- Welcome Bonuses: Typically offered to new players, these may consist of matched deposit bonuses or free spins, effectively increasing initial bankrolls.
- Free Spins: Spin opportunities awarded without additional cost, often tied to specific slot releases or promotional periods.
- Cashback Offers: Return a percentage of losses over a defined period, encouraging continued play without the immediate risk of losing capital.
- Reload Bonuses: Incentives provided to existing players to recharge their accounts, maintaining ongoing engagement.
The Regulatory Landscape and Its Impact on Promotions
Regulatory frameworks across different jurisdictions heavily influence promotional practices. For instance, within the European Union, strict advertising standards and player protection measures necessitate transparent promotional terms and responsible gambling commitments. Conversely, regions with looser regulations may allow more aggressive promotional tactics but risk legal repercussions and damage to reputation.
Industry leaders often adhere to standards set by organizations such as the Malta Gambling Authority or the UK Gambling Commission, which require clear disclosure of bonus conditions, wagering requirements, and fairness assurances. Compliance ensures not only legal operation but also consumer trust—an essential component for sustainable growth.
